Question

Do I report the income of my 16 year old daughter whom 8 am claiming as a dependant?

She lived with me all year and I provided 100% of her support

if her unearned income  - taxable interest, dividends, capital gains - is over $1150 she must either file her own return using form 8615 which requires the parents to complete their return first because her tax is based on the parents taxable income + her own or the parents can include her income on their return by filing form 8814.

 

 

one advantage of parents filing on their return is that there's only one return to file. disadvantages possibly greater investment income tax and possibly higher tax on child's income.  filing one return and including her income may cost up to $115 in additional taxes then if she filed her own return.
